What Affects the INR to CRC Rate

Exchange rates between Indian Rupee and Costa Rican Colón are influenced by central bank interest rate decisions, inflation differentials, trade balances, and broader economic data releases from both countries. Political stability, commodity prices, and global risk sentiment can also cause significant moves. Monitoring these factors helps explain why the INR/CRC rate fluctuates throughout trading sessions and over longer time periods.

How to Get the Best INR to CRC Rate

To minimize conversion costs, compare the rate offered by your bank or transfer service against the mid-market rate shown on this page. Online money transfer services and fintech apps often provide rates 2-3% better than traditional banks. For larger amounts, the savings from finding a competitive rate can be substantial. Always check the total cost including both the exchange rate markup and any fixed fees charged by the provider.

CRC - Costa Rican Colón
The Costa Rican Colon (CRC) is the official currency of Costa Rica. Tourism, medical devices, and technology exports drive Central America's most stable economy.
